The ADVIA Chemistry XPT Crea assay is a laboratory test used to measure the level of creatinine, a waste product, in a patient's blood or urine sample. It is a core function of this assay to provide a quantitative analysis of creatinine concentration.

Comprehensive Biomarker Analysis in Critical Illness

Blood samples were immediately drawn upon admission. The serum lactate levels in mmol/L (ADVIA Chemistry XPT® LAC Assay, Siemens, Germany; reference level 0.5.2.2 mmol/L) were assessed as a serum biomarker for CP parameters. Furthermore, C-reactive protein (CRP) in mg/L (ADVIA Chemistry XPT®, Siemens, Germany), white blood cell count in giga/L (XE 5000 Hematology Analyzer, Sysmex, Germany), hemoglobin levels in g/dL (XE 5000 Hematology Analyzer, Sysmex, Germany), hematocrit levels in L/L (XE 5000 Hematology Analyzer, Sysmex, Germany), cholinesterase in U/L (ADVIA Chemistry XPT®, Siemens, Germany), blood glucose levels in mg/dL (ADVIA Chemistry XPT®, Siemens, Germany), pH values (ABL800 FLEX; Radiometer, Copenhagen, Denmark and Krefeld, Germany), albumin levels in g/L (ADVIA Chemistry XPT®, Siemens, Germany), creatinine in mg/dL (ADVIA Chemistry XPT Crea assay, Siemens, Germany), cortisol levels in µg/dL (ADVIA Centaur XPT®, Siemens, Germany), and troponin I in µg/dL (ADVIA Centaur XPT®, Siemens, Germany) upon admission were analyzed in the entire study population.

Serum Biomarkers in Neurosurgical Patients

Blood samples were immediately drawn upon the patients’ admission to the neurosurgical department. Serum lactate levels in mmol/L (ADVIA Chemistry XPT® LAC Assay, Siemens, Germany) were defined as serum biomarkers for CP parameters. In addition, white blood cell count in giga/L (XE 5000 Hematology Analyzer, Sysmex, Germany), hemoglobin level in g/dL (XE 5000 Hematology Analyzer, Sysmex, Germany), hematocrit level in L/L (XE 5000 Hematology Analyzer, Sysmex, Germany), cholinesterase in U/L (ADVIA Chemistry XPT®, Siemens, Germany), blood glucose level in mg/dL (ADVIA Chemistry XPT®, Siemens, Germany), serum lactate level in mmol/L (ADVIA Chemistry XPT®, Siemens, Germany), troponin I in µg/dL (ADVIA Centaur XPT®, Siemens, Germany), cortisol level in µg/dL (ADVIA Centaur XPT®, Siemens, Germany), C-reactive protein (CRP) in mg/L (ADVIA Chemistry XPT®, Siemens, Germany), albumin level in g/L (ADVIA Chemistry XPT®, Siemens, Germany), creatine in mg/dL (ADVIA Chemistry XPT Crea assay; Siemens, Germany), prothrombin time in % (Atellica® COAG 360 System, Siemens, Germany), partial thromboplastin time in sec (Atellica® COAG 360 System, Siemens, Germany), antithrombin III in %/NORM (Atellica® COAG 360 System, Siemens, Germany), and fibrinogen in g/L (Atellica® COAG 360 System, Siemens, Germany) upon admission were recorded and analyzed in all of the included patients.
